Galvanized steel sheet coil refers to steel that has been coated with a layer of zinc to enhance its corrosion resistance. This process, known as galvanization, involves immersing steel in molten zinc or using an electroplating process. The result is a durable and long-lasting material suitable for outdoor use and in environments prone to moisture.
Standard steel, often referred to as carbon steel, is a versatile metal that does not have any protective coating. While it is strong and can be shaped for various applications, it is susceptible to rust and corrosion, especially when exposed to harsh weather conditions.
One of the most significant differences between galvanized steel sheet coil and standard steel is corrosion resistance. The zinc coating on galvanized steel provides a protective barrier that significantly reduces the risk of rust when exposed to moisture and harsh environments. Standard steel, lacking this protective layer, is highly vulnerable to oxidation, leading to deterioration over time.
Because galvanized steel is resistant to corrosion, it tends to have a longer lifespan compared to standard steel. In many cases, galvanized steel can last up to 50 years or more with proper maintenance, while standard steel may require frequent replacement or extensive treatment to prolong its life.
While galvanized steel sheet coil generally has a higher upfront cost due to the manufacturing process involved in galvanization, it can be more cost-effective in the long run. The lower maintenance requirements and extended lifespan can offset the initial investment, particularly for projects where longevity is crucial. Standard steel, being less expensive initially, may lead to higher maintenance costs down the line.
Both materials have distinct applications based on their properties. Galvanized steel is commonly used in outdoor construction, agricultural applications, and manufacturing where corrosion resistance is vital. Standard steel, on the other hand, is frequently found in indoor applications such as furniture and automotive parts, where exposure to moisture is minimal.
When it comes to aesthetics, galvanized steel generally has a distinctive, shiny appearance due to its zinc coating. This may be desirable in certain design projects. Standard steel, while it can be finished or painted, often lacks the same visual appeal without additional treatment.
